Webb29 jan. 2011 · Risk = Hazard + Outrage: Peter Sandman on Risk Communication petersandman1 181 subscribers 25K views 11 years ago This clip is a brief excerpt ( 9:37) from a two-day seminar I … Webb13 juli 2015 · A risk, in this view, is never just a hazard: Risk = Hazard + Outrage. The outrage factor may be anywhere from negligible to catastrophically high. Any situation with a high potential outrage factor is high risk, even if only a small direct hazard to people is involved. Sandman lists 20 components that contribute to the potential for outrage.
